Transaction 7493e3534453558ed105bb80905408a424d0a694117c97cc4e564921a3deb210

2 Input
2 Outputs
  • 7493e3534453558ed105bb80905408a424d0a694117c97cc4e564921a3deb210:0
  • value  15649133
    address  1FZRo2ofPZhHFDgMtg8BW2zMdNDVyKTJLR
  • 7493e3534453558ed105bb80905408a424d0a694117c97cc4e564921a3deb210:1
  • value  968240
    address  17eRi54BfLvb5QykJwb7D8WU6TB71St7AL